Understanding Sliding Door Wheels
Sliding door wheels, also known as rollers or guides, are designed to facilitate smooth movement along a track. They allow doors to glide effortlessly, preventing jamming or sticking, which can be particularly frustrating over time. These wheels can be made from various materials, including nylon, steel, and plastic, each offering unique benefits that cater to different weights and door styles.
Factors to Consider When Buying Sliding Door Wheels
1. Weight Capacity One of the primary considerations when selecting sliding door wheels is weight capacity. Heavier doors require sturdier wheels that can bear the load without bending or breaking. Ensure that the wheels you choose match or exceed the weight of your sliding door for optimal performance.
2. Material The material of the wheels impacts durability and noise levels. Nylon wheels are typically quiet and less prone to corrosion, while metal wheels offer greater strength and longevity. For outdoor or high-moisture environments, consider wheels made from stainless steel to prevent rusting.
3. Wheel Diameter The diameter of the wheel can influence how smoothly the door glides. Larger wheels may move more effortlessly but could also require more space. Conversely, smaller wheels might work in tighter spaces but can become less effective with heavier doors.
4. Track Compatibility Different sliding doors utilize various types of tracks. Before purchasing wheels, ensure they are compatible with your existing track. Measure the track width and any grooves to find wheels that will fit correctly and provide smooth operation.
5. Style and Design While functionality is crucial, aesthetics should also be considered. Some sliding door wheels are designed to be discreet, while others may have a decorative element. Choose a style that complements your doorway and overall interior decor.
6. Adjustability Some wheels come with adjustable features, allowing you to fine-tune the height of the door. This can be particularly helpful for achieving a perfect alignment or compensating for uneven flooring. Look for wheels with easy-to-use adjustment mechanisms for added convenience.

Installation Tips
Once you’ve purchased the right sliding door wheels, proper installation is key to ensuring optimal performance. If you’re replacing existing wheels, begin by removing the door from its track. Clean the track thoroughly to remove any dust or debris. Install the new wheels according to the manufacturer’s instructions, and make sure the door is correctly aligned before sliding it back into place.
